Singer, producer, actor and TV host, Klevis Bega aka Kastro Zizo is often called the Father of Urban Rock in Albania. In 1997 he co-founded the popular rock band “2 Farm” which garnered critical and commercial acclaim before embarking on a successful solo artist career.  Delivering socially conscious lyrics and folk-rock original sound, Kastro Zizo has revolutionized Albanian art history, influencing generations of artists.

Zizo has released 5 hit albums, “Ja ke fut kot” (2 Farm, 2001), “Komplet Komplot” (2005), “Se keshtu e doni ju” (2007), “Ketri, Pula dhe Njeriu” (2010), and “Karantina” (2020). Kastro Zizo became an international sensation on the big screen when he landed the leading role in the drama feature film “Pharmakon” (2012, dir. Joni Shanj), starring as “Branko”. The film was selected as the Albanian entry for the Best Foreign Language Oscar at the 85th Academy Awards in 2013. “Pharmakon” won the Jury’s Special Price at the Albanian National Film Festival (2012), Award of Merit at Lucerne International Film Festival (2013), and Best Actress Award at Levante International Film Festival (2013).

Kastro Zizo starred on RTV Ora’s Late-Night Show with with Kastro Zizo and Rrokum Nights with Kastro Zizo in Prishtina. He was a celebrity contestant of Dance with the Stars Albania, Your Face Sounds Familiar, Dance Albania, reaching millions of viewers.

In 2020 Kastro Zizo founded his non-profit organization “My future, my present,” (E ardhmja ime, e tashmja ime) to promote the rights of youth through advocacy and organizing activities. Founded in Tirana, the non-profit organization creates opportunities for youth in education, dialogue activities, youth development, arts, culture and social issues.

Kastro Zizo was born in 1984 in Albania. He is a graduate of Sapienza University of Rome, Italy, majoring in Cosmology and Astrophysics. He served as an Assistant Professor of Astronomy at the University of Tirana, Faculty of Math and Physics. He has two sons and a daughter and resides with his wife, Sara.
